Personal information
o Names as it appears on social security card for you, Social Security numbers and dates of birth for you, your spouse, and your dependents;
o Mailing address
o Telephone number
o Email address
o Bank account number and routing number, for direct deposit of refund or direct debit for tax payment
Income Information for you and your spouse (if married filing joint)
o W-2 for employment income
o W-2G for Gambling
o 1099-MISC for completed contract work and earned more than $600
o Business income and accounting records for expenses, list of capital expenses with date and purchase price, business use of home – total area and area used for business, home expenses – auto mileage – total miles driven and total business miles
o Rental Income, expenses and suspended loss carryover information
o 1099-G forms for unemployment benefits, and state tax refund
o SSA-1099 for Social Security benefits received
o 1099-R for payments/distributions from IRAs or retirement plans including RMD
o 1099-INT, -DIV, for investment or interest income
o 1099-B proceeds from sale of bonds or stocks, and income from foreign investments. If you have exercised employee stock ownership plan, please check with your employer finance office for additional information on stock granted.
o K-1 form(s) from SCorp, Partnership or Estates
o 1099-S income for sale of a property (principal residence or business property). More information i.e. purchase and sales dates and cost basis is required
o 1099-C Cancellation of Debt
o Miscellaneous income (including: jury duty, lottery, Form 1099-MISC for prizes and awards, and Form 1099-MSA for distributions from medical savings accounts and scholarships)
o Form 6252 installment sale information for prior year
o Alimony received.
Adjustments to income
o Form 1098-E for student loan interest paid
o Educator Expenses for Teachers: expenses paid for classroom supplies
o IRA contributions made during the year
o Health Saving Account contribution
o Self-employed health insurance payment records
o Records of moving expenses
o Alimony paid
o Self-employed SEP, SIMPLE, and qualified pension plans
Deductions and credits
o Forms 1098: Mortgage interest, private mortgage insurance (PMI), and points paid. If home was bought during reporting tax year, escrow closing statement for certain deductible expenses
o Property Taxes paid
o Personal property tax, vehicle license fee
o Charitable contribution: List of donees with amounts of cash and non-cash. For non-cash contribution of over $500, additional information required – donees name, address, purchase price and date of donated property, and evaluation method and miles driven for charitable purpose
o Medical and dental expenses (first 10% of your AGI is not deductible)
o Casualty and theft losses: amount of loss and insurance reimbursements
o Union dues
o Unreimbursed employee expenses (continuing education, uniforms, supplies and equipment, seminars, subscriptions, publications, travel, parking fee, etc.)
o Child Adoption Expense: SSN of adopted child; details of adoption expenses
o Other Miscellaneous expenses – investment, safe deposit box, gambling losses to the extent of winnings
o Education Credit: Form 1098-T for tuition paid for college education and record of other education expenses such as books and supplies
o Child care Expenses: Care provider’s name, address, tax ID, telephone number and total amount paid for each qualified child
o Qualified energy-efficient home improvements expenses.(solar, windows)
Other Information
o Estimated Taxes paid during the year
o Prior year refund applied to current year
o If filed Extension Application, estimated taxes paid with extension
o Foreign bank account information: Country, account number, name of bank, highest balance of account during the year
